Getting There
-
Public Transport - Metro
If you are in central Stockholm, head to the nearest metro station, T-Centralen. From T-Centralen, take the Green Line (Line 19 or 17) towards Skarpnäck or Kungsträdgården. Get off at the station 'Slussen'. Once you exit the station, follow the signs towards Katarinavägen. Walk approximately 300 meters along Katarinavägen until you reach the Katarina Elevator at Katarinavägen 3.
-
Public Transport - Bus
From your current location, find the nearest bus stop and take Bus 76 towards 'Skanstull'. Get off at the stop 'Katarina Bangata'. From there, walk about 200 meters along Katarinavägen until you arrive at the Katarina Elevator located at Katarinavägen 3.
-
Walking
If you are already in the Sodermalm area, simply walk towards Katarinavägen. Depending on your exact location, make your way to Sodermalm's main streets such as Götgatan or Hornsgatan. Head towards the water, and you will find Katarinavägen. Walk along this road until you reach the Katarina Elevator at Katarinavägen 3. It's a pleasant walk with great views of the city.
